5 Places to Dine Outside in Missoula
After being cooped up inside all winter, most Missoulians want to spend every possible moment outside as the weather begins to turn warmer — even at mealtime. Luckily, many Missoula restaurants boast awesome outdoor seating areas to accommodate the summer crowd. Here are five local al fresco favorites:
- 1
The Old Post
The deck behind the Old Post provides a great atmosphere any time of the day, whether you’re enjoying a tasty weekend brunch or an evening cocktail. The wooden framing and decorative vegetation give the area a casual, relaxed vibe — not to mention a few spots of shade for those of us who burn easily.
- 2
The Iron Horse
The I-Ho has one of the largest outdoor patio areas in town, which is a good thing, as it is a very popular spot during the summer months. As an added bonus, there is a sweet fireplace to help keep you warm long after the sun goes down.
- 3
Sapore
Sapore’s half-indoor, half-outdoor front patio is pretty darn cool — both visually and functionally. Diners have an entertaining view of Higgins Avenue, and if downtown Missoula is hit with a surprise summer thunderstorm (a common occurrence in Western Montana), customers can easily slide their tables underneath the overhang.
- 4
Finn & Porter
As far as scenery goes, you really can’t beat the view from Finn & Porter’s riverside deck, which overlooks the mighty Clark Fork and the Kim Williams Trail. Plus, the rushing water creates a refreshing cooling effect — perfect for a hot summer evening.
